Takeaways
- 😀 Mercury is the closest planet to the Sun, with an extreme temperature range from 430°C in the daytime to -1°C at night.
- 😀 Venus, often called Earth's twin due to its similar size, has a thick atmosphere filled with sulfuric acid clouds and surface temperatures reaching 470°C.
- 😀 Earth is the only known planet with life, thanks to its vast oceans, oxygen-rich atmosphere, and biodiversity.
- 😀 Mars, known as the Red Planet, is most similar to Earth and is home to the tallest mountain, Olympus Mons, and the largest canyon, Valles Marineris.
- 😀 Jupiter is the largest planet in the solar system, featuring the famous Great Red Spot, a storm that has lasted for over 400 years.
- 😀 Saturn is renowned for its stunning rings, which are made of ice and rock particles orbiting the planet.
- 😀 Uranus is an ice giant that rotates on its side, with extreme seasons where each pole experiences 42 years of continuous daylight or night.
- 😀 Neptune, the farthest planet from the Sun, has the strongest winds in the solar system, reaching speeds of up to 2,100 km/h.
- 😀 Mercury has a day longer than its year due to its slow rotation.
- 😀 Neptune's blue color comes from methane in its atmosphere, which absorbs red light, making the planet appear blue.
Q & A
What makes Mercury unique compared to other planets?
-Mercury's uniqueness lies in its slow rotation, which causes its day to be longer than its year. It also experiences extreme temperature fluctuations, ranging from 430°C during the day to -1°C at night.
Why is Venus often referred to as Earth's twin?
-Venus is called Earth's twin because it is similar in size to Earth. However, its atmosphere is thick with sulfuric acid clouds, and surface temperatures reach up to 470°C, making it an inhospitable environment.
What is Earth's most notable characteristic in the solar system?
-Earth is unique because it is the only planet known to support life, thanks to its vast oceans, rich oxygen atmosphere, and biodiversity. Its natural satellite, the Moon, also plays a key role in influencing tidal forces.
What makes Mars similar to Earth?
-Mars is often called the 'Red Planet' due to its reddish appearance. It has geological features similar to Earth, such as the highest mountain in the solar system, Olympus Mons, and the largest canyon, Valles Marineris.
What is the significance of Jupiter's Great Red Spot?
-Jupiter's Great Red Spot is a giant storm that has been raging for over 400 years, making it one of the most famous features of the planet. It is one of the largest and most persistent weather systems in the solar system.
Why is Saturn famous for its rings?
-Saturn is well known for its spectacular rings, which are made up of particles of ice and rock. These rings are slowly disappearing due to the planet's gravitational pull, which is gradually drawing the particles inward.
What makes Uranus distinct from other planets in the solar system?
-Uranus is unique because it rotates on its side, like a rolling ball. Its cold atmosphere is made of hydrogen, helium, and methane, and the planet experiences extreme seasons, with each pole experiencing day or night for 42 years.
How does Neptune's atmosphere contribute to its color?
-Neptune appears blue because of methane in its atmosphere, which absorbs red light and reflects blue light. This gives the planet its characteristic blue color.
What are the strongest winds in the solar system, and where can they be found?
-The strongest winds in the solar system can be found on Neptune, reaching speeds of up to 2,100 km/h. These intense winds are a defining feature of the planet's atmosphere.
How do the moons of Mars relate to its gravitational field?
-Mars has two small moons, Phobos and Deimos, which are believed to be captured asteroids. Their small size and irregular shapes suggest they were gravitationally pulled into orbit around Mars.
